Output 6279108c0428c2f0fe7706588fcc9b427a2bfd61f44d1a4b39b5e91ce3fc4008:5

value
20709187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93134cd62f093e2e16bb7d765ded8874529c5d09 OP_EQUAL
address
3F6gNjtZo8aQKrYhdPCkearY8iydoeNHpv
transaction
6279108c0428c2f0fe7706588fcc9b427a2bfd61f44d1a4b39b5e91ce3fc4008
spent
true